Is Le Pain Quotidien clean?

Le Pain Quotidien is currently Grade A from NYC Department of Health and Mental Hygiene (DOHMH), from an inspection on July 25, 2025. Inspectors wrote up 2 critical violations β€” the kind most directly linked to foodborne illness. On Cooked's ladder that reads clean πŸ˜‡.

What did inspectors find at Le Pain Quotidien?

These are the violations recorded at the most recent inspection on July 25, 2025, in plain English, with the city's own wording underneath.

  • 🧽surfaces not properly sanitizedcritical
    Food contact surface not properly washed, rinsed and sanitized after each use and following any activity when contamination may have occurred.
  • 🌑️fridge is giving… room tempcritical
    Cold TCS food item held above 41 Β°F; smoked or processed fish held above 38 Β°F; intact raw eggs held above 45 Β°F; or reduced oxygen packaged (ROP) TCS foods held above required temperatures except during active necessary preparation.

How New York grades restaurants

New York City health inspectors score violations in points, and lower is better: 0–13 points earns an A, 14–27 a B, and 28 or more a C. Every restaurant is inspected at least once a year, and the letter has to be posted in the window. A restaurant that scores 14 or more on the first inspection of a cycle does not get a letter right away β€” it stays β€œGrade Pending” until a re-inspection settles it, which is why some spots here show an hourglass instead of a letter.
